Ingredients:

  • 2 cups (250 g) all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 3/4 cup (170 g) butter, melted
  • 1 cup (200 g) sugar
  • 1/2 cup (100 g) brown s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 2 cups (340 g) chocolate chips

Method:

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F). This step is crucial to ensure your cookies bake evenly and develop that irresistible golden crust.

Step 2: Mix the Dry Ingredients

In a b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t. This dry mixture sets the stage for building flavor and structure in your cookies.

Step 3: Combine Butter and Sugars

In another bowl, pour in your melted butter and add both the white and brown sugars. Mix until smooth. This step is what gives the cookies their luscious, sweet flavor.

Step 4: Add Egg and Vanilla

Add the egg and vanilla extract to the butter-sugar mix, and stir well until fully combined. This is the moment where everything starts to come together—trust me, it smells delightful!

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Gently f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ture. Be careful not to overmix; your cookies will thank you for keeping them tender.

Step 6: Fold in the Chocolate Chips

Now comes the fun part! Fold in those glorious chocolate chips,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the batter, ready to melt into sweet perfection as they bake.

Step 7: Drop on Baking Sheets

Using a spoon, drop thin spoonfuls of cookie dough onto your prepared baking sheets. Give them some space to spread out a bit—roughly 2 inches apart should do the trick!

Step 8: Bake to Perfection

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ake for 10–12 minutes until the edges are golden and crisp. Keep an eye on them; ovens can be sneaky!

Step 9: Cool Completely

Once you’ve pulled the cookies from the oven, allow them to cool completely on a wire rack. This step is essential for giving them that delightful crispiness.

Storage & Leftovers Guide

To keep your cookies crispy,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you anticipate a longer storage time, consider freezing the dough or baked cookies. Just pop them in a Ziploc bag, and they’ll stay good for up to three months. Thaw them overnight before baking or enjoying!

Kitchen Wisdom & Success Tips

  • Always remember to measure your ingredients accurately! Spoon flour into your cup and level it off with a flat edge to avoid dense cookies.
  • If you prefer chewier cookies, take them out of the oven a minute or two early.
  • Want to add a personal twist? Try adding a pinch of sea salt on top before baking for a delightful salty-sweet contrast.

Flavor Variations & Adaptations

Feel free to experiment! Add nuts, dried fruits, or even swap out some chocolate chips for white chocolate or peanut butter chips. For a nutty flavor, consider adding a teaspoon of almond extract. The possibilities are endless!

Reader Questions & Solutions

  • How do I know if my cookies are done? Look for the edges to be golden brown while the centers will appear slightly undercooked. They will firm up as they cool.
  • Can I use margarine instead of butter? While you can, it might alter the flavor and texture slightly. I recommend sticking with butter for the best results.
  • What if my dough seems too dry? If it feels crumbly, you can add a teaspoon of milk to bring it together, making it easier to scoop.
  • How do I prevent my cookies from spreading too much? Chill the dough for about 30 minutes before baking to help them maintain shape.
  • Is there a gluten-free option? You can substitute the all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end for a similar result.
